What ADAS Recalibration Is & Why It Matters After Windshield Replacement

Advanced Driver Assistance Systems (ADAS) are only as accurate as the sensors and cameras powering them, and many of those components are tied directly to your windshield. A fresh install can slightly alter the position of these devices, which may throw off your vehicle’s ability to track lanes, judge distances, or trigger automatic braking.

To avoid false readings or delayed reactions, our team performs post-replacement ADAS recalibration in Oakland, CA. With the right tools and specs, we get your system dialed back in, so your vehicle stays smart and responsive on the road.

Common ADAS Features That Depend on Proper Calibration

From highways to stop-and-go city traffic, today’s driver-assistance systems are always at work. These systems depend on camera and sensor placement to read road conditions in real time, so if your windshield is replaced, recalibration becomes critical.

Below are some of the key safety systems that depend on accurate calibration.

Automatic Emergency Braking (AEB)

This life-saving feature helps your car react faster than human reflexes by detecting vehicles or obstacles ahead and applying the brakes. Without proper ADAS calibration, AEB might engage too late, or not at all.

Lane Keeping Assist System (LKAS)

Using the forward-facing camera, LKAS keeps you centered in your lane. If your camera is off by even a fraction of a degree after a windshield replacement, the system may fail to alert you or steer incorrectly.

Adaptive Cruise Control (ACC)

This system maintains a safe following distance from vehicles ahead. Recalibration keeps its radar and camera in sync so your vehicle adjusts speed accurately, especially on crowded Bay Area highways.

Signs Your ADAS System Is Out of Alignment

The signs of misalignment aren’t always obvious, but staying alert to small changes in performance can help prevent bigger problems on the road.

Here’s what to watch for:

  • Dashboard warning lights or error messages
  • Lane assist or cruise control features not activating
  • Irregular braking or steering behavior
  • Cameras or sensors that appear visually misaligned
  • Recent windshield replacement without recalibration

Can ADAS calibration be performed reliably outdoors in Oakland, or does it require an indoor setup?

While some static recalibrations can be performed outdoors in ideal conditions, most vehicles require a controlled environment for accurate results. That’s why we offer in-shop ADAS recalibration right here in Oakland.

Does recalibration need to be repeated if I get an alignment or suspension repair?

Yes. Because ADAS relies on fixed reference points tied to your vehicle’s frame and suspension, any changes to ride height or alignment may require recalibration.
